Here's the series description, updated for v3: This is a new series that replaces two different series from last year. The first is this series Simon and I wrote, here: [PATCH 00/10] Step over thread exit (PR gdb/27338) https://sourceware.org/pipermail/gdb-patches/2021-July/180567.html The other is a series that coincidentally, back then, Andrew posted at about the same time, and that addressed problems in kind of the mirror scenario. His patch series was about stepping over clone (creating new threads), instead of stepping over thread exit: [PATCH 0/3] Stepping over clone syscall https://sourceware.org/pipermail/gdb-patches/2021-June/180517.html My & Simon's solution back then involved adding a new contract between GDB and GDBserver -- if a thread is single stepping, and it exits, the server was supposed to report back the thread's exit to GDB. One of the motivations for this approach was to be able to control the enablement of thread exit events per thread, to avoid creating thread-exit event traffic unnecessarily, as done by target_thread_events()/QThreadEvents. Andrew's solution involves using the QThreadEvents mechanism, which tells the server to report thread create and thread exit events for all threads. This would conflict with the desire to avoid unnecessary traffic in the step over thread exit series. The step over clone fixes back then also weren't yet fully complete, as Andrew's series only addressed inline step overs. Fixing displaced stepping over clone syscall would still remain broken. This new series fixes all of stepping over thread exit and clone, for both of displaced stepping and inline step overs. It: - Merges both Andrew's and my/Simon's series, and then reworks both parts in different ways. - Introduces clone events at the GDB core and remote protocol level. - Gets rid of the idea of "reporting thread exit if thread is single-stepping", replaces it by a new mechanism GDB can use to explicitly enable thread clone and/or thread exit events, and other events in the future. The old mechanism also only worked when the remote server supported hardware single-stepping. This new approach has an advantage of also working on software single-step targets. - Uses the new clone events to fix displaced stepping over clone syscalls too. - Addresses an issue that Andrew alluded to in his series, and that coincidentally, we/AMD also ran into with AMDGPU debugging -- currently, with "set scheduler-locking on", if you step over a function that spawns a thread, that thread runs free, for a bit at least, and then may stop or not, basically in an unspecified manner. - Addresses Simon's review comments on the original "Step over thread exit" series referenced above. - Centralizes "[Thread ...exited]" notifications in core code. - Cancels next/step/until/etc. commands on thread exit event, like so: (gdb) n [Thread 0x7ffff7d89700 (LWP 3961883) exited] Command aborted, thread exited.
